Jack Leggett's Situation
Jun 29, 2011, 7:52 PM
|
|
I believe Jack Leggett is in an undesirable situation as far as coaching at a particular program is concerned. Clemson’s archrival is South Carolina, a team that has just won consecutive national titles in baseball. Henceforth, nothing that Leggett achieves short of a national title will satisfy or pacify the Clemson fan base. Appearances in the CWS without a ring will no longer suffice as the fans will remain disgruntled. Only championships will make them happy.
None of the excuses will longer work: he needs more time, his teams had injuries (so did Tanner’s), his players are young, ad infinitum. Tanner’s team just finds ways to win.
A program is often judged by the success of its most hated rival. When your archrival reaches a championship level, you also better follow suit and win a title to keep the fan base content. I may be wrong in my theory, but it is interesting that several heated archrivals have won national titles within a close time frame. UNC won the 1993 men’s basketball title a year after Duke repeated as champs.
Duke basketball earned a national title in 2010, a year after UNC did it in 2009.
The Tar Heels were the 1982 hoops winner. NC State (then a dominant program) followed suit in 1983.
Alabama was the BCS champ in 2009. Auburn follows suit a year thereafter.
The Crimson Tide won the football crown in 1992. War Eagle goes undefeated in 1993, but was unable to play for the title because of probation.
The LA Lakers and Boston Celtics regularly traded NBA titles in the hotly contested 1980s.
Notre Dame and USC, in their glory days, also traded football titles.
FSU wins it all in football in 1993 and Florida gets its trophy in 1996.
More examples probably exist, but I must avoid a laundry list (too late). I simply cannot see how Jack Leggett will be truly appreciated at Clemson if he never accomplishes the CWS championship. Wilhelm also lacked a CWS trophy, but had the good fortune of having a rival that had no rings as well. For Leggett, no such buffer remains.
